Kraken Halts Monero Deposits Following 51% Attack on Privacy Blockchain

Crypto exchange Kraken has temporarily suspended Monero (XMR) deposits due to a 51% attack on the privacy-focused blockchain. The security incident poses a risk to the network’s integrity and stability.
